Postby thehat » Mon Jun 16, 2003 6:08 pm

Whoa!!! Hold on a moment here. Cabrera is almost definitely not going to be brought up this soon. The Marlins would wait till whatever date it is in August that would insure they get to keep another full season till he gets arbitration rights. That cheap outfit is all about the Benjamins, so you can take this to the bank, I would think.
